Output 0265a75c75fa30e69d90dbfa57b5ec80d7361d088680e22c7f196cd3cb0fd9e2:3

value
40144926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b7c7abf833f8e5d677c55982dc7ff505870d44 OP_EQUAL
address
MFtyBNjHrSeZCZjUrDQtawR89DsvknHhCV
transaction
0265a75c75fa30e69d90dbfa57b5ec80d7361d088680e22c7f196cd3cb0fd9e2
spent
true